I have a ceramic bearings bottom bracket since 2008 or so.. It's one of those item that you put on your bike and fuhgeddaboutit; never needs maintenance, even though I ride that bike all season, through winter salt, mud, rain, etc... Over ten years and I have yet to take it apart to inspect whether it needs cleaning.
I can't tell whether ceramic has less friction that other bottom bracket material, but I like the zero maintenance over ten years of usage.
If you have a bike that you plan on keeping for long time, it might be worthwhile to invest in ceramic stuff just to save you some maintenance time on the bike.
